Thus, the function when x<-2 … NettetWe can extend this idea to limits at infinity. For example, consider the function f(x) = 2 + 1 x. As can be seen graphically in Figure 4.40 and numerically in Table 4.2, as the values of x get larger, the values of f(x) approach 2. We say the limit as x approaches ∞ of f(x) is 2 and write lim x → ∞f(x) = 2. Similarly, for x < 0, as the ...

NettetQ: 2 Find the vertical and horizontal asymptotes of the function y = x²-x 2x for horizontal asymptoles… A: Here we will get the vertical Asymptotes by putting denominator equal to zero, and we will find the… Nettet26. aug. 2016 · How do you find the limit of x x as x approaches 0? Calculus Limits Determining Limits Algebraically 1 Answer Eddie Aug 26, 2016 Does not exist Explanation: For x < 0, x x = −x x = −1 For x > 0, x x = x x = 1 Thus lim x→0− x x = −1 lim x→0+ x x = 1 So the limit does not exist. graph { x /x [-10, 10, -5, 5]} Answer link
